South Korea - Import of Optical Fibres and Cables
Since 2014, South Korea Import of Optical Fibres and Cables was down by 9.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 33 among other countries in Import of Optical Fibres and Cables with $57,666,865.54. South Korea is overtaken by India, which was number 32 with $63,825,272.06 and is followed by Denmark at $54,892,692. United States topped the ranking with $1,298,456,879.61 in 2019, that is a growth of 3.3% compared to 2018. Mexico, France and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ands witnessed the best average annual growth at +71%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-50.8% per year.
